Rajiv Gandhi University of Health Sciences
Second Year M. Sc. (Nursing) Degree Examination - APRIL 2017
[Time: 3 Hours]
[Max. Marks: 80]
GASTRO ENTEROLOGY NURSING
(Revised Scheme 3)
Q.P. CODE: 9647
Your answers should be specific to the questions asked.
Draw neat labeled diagrams wherever necessary.
ANSWER THE FOLLOWING
4 X 15 = 60 Marks
1.
Mr. Ravi, 60 year old man is admitted with acute small intestinal onstruction.
a) Explain the etiology and pathophysiology of small intrerstinal obstruction.
b) Discuss the clinical manifestations and the immediate management of acute intestinal
obstruction.
c) Draw a nursing care plan for Mr. Ravi for the first 24 hours following nursing process
approach.
(3+5+7)
2.
Explain the Intensive Gastroenterology Unit (IGEU) based on the following aspects.
a) Design and layout
b) Quality assurance and patient care evaluation
c) Infection control and standard safety measures
(4+5+6)
3.
Mr. X is admitted with severe gastrointestinal bleeding secondary to portal hypertension.
a) Discuss the etiology and the pathophysiology of portal hypertension.
b) Explain the management of bleeding oesophageal varices.
c) Discuss the nursing management of Mr. X.
(4+4+7)
4.
Mr. A is admitted with gastric cancer.
a) Discuss the predisposing factors and the assessment findings of gastric cancer.
b) Explain the diagnosis, medical and surgical intervention of gastric cancer.
c) Discuss the postoperative nursing intervention and the dietary guidelines after gastric
surgery.
SHORT NOTES (Answer any TWO)
2 X 10 = 20 Marks
5.
Discuss on diaphragmatic hernia.
6.
Describe the drugs used in peptic ulcer.
7.
Explain in detail about Liver transplantation.
8.
Discuss on Meckel's diverticulum.
